The first step as an affiliate is to find a product to promote. You can either find products or services from individual websites (such as SEO Press, SEMrush) or pick products from affiliate product market platforms such as Amazon Associates, CJ, ShareASale, ClickBank, etc.

Constant Contact offers powerful email marketing tools for small businesses, bloggers, and entrepreneurs. Among other things, users of Constant Contact can use the tools to create Instagram and Facebook Ads, automate their email marketing campaigns, or target new ecommerce customers and send follow-up emails to increase revenue to their online stores.

Some people use affiliate marketing only for profit, not to benefit their customers. Some will even mislead their audience with spammy, dishonest affiliate ads and promotions, or they try to hide the fact that it’s an affiliate link. Here’s a tip: most readers can smell them a mile away—and that’s okay, if you’re honest about the intent!
